## Formula sandbox tuning

User-supplied formulas in Gridmoor execute inside a restricted interpreter with hard ceilings on time, memory, and call depth. Reviewers should confirm any change to these ceilings is justified in the PR description, since raising them widens the abuse surface. Defaults were chosen from production traces. The current limits are as follows.

limits module of tafog-fawip:
WEIGHTS = {
    "julix": 57,
    "lamys": 992,
    "kasvan": 209,
    "quenok": 750,
    "alddor": 259,
    "oliath": 1009,
    "wenix": 815,
}

Subject: Gross-Margin Review — Q3 Findings

Team,

Ahead of Director Halvesen's arrival, I've completed the gross-margin review for the Corvata product line. Margins compressed 2.1 points quarter-over-quarter, driven primarily by freight surcharges on the Ostermill route and discounting in the Velden region. Mitigations are scoped, though pricing adjustments need executive sign-off before month-end. Full workings are in the shared review folder. Please treat the following note as strictly confidential until the board has reviewed it.

confidential, bahof-yaweg: Headcount on the Kaseth team goes from 32 to 109 by the end of January. Gross margin on Kaseth came in at 46 percent against a plan of 45 percent.

The refactored Orlique data layer replaces the legacy ORM's string-built queries with parameterized statements issued through a central gateway, closing the injection vectors flagged in last quarter's review. All gateway traffic is authenticated and logged, and schema migrations now require signed manifests. For your audit environment, the gateway accepts a scoped read-only credential. Authenticate your review tooling with the key below.

app token of tagef-tafog = qvz3-7n0